Been in rotation for some time now, old cut still blows all these new orange flavors away, she may not have a catchy name n she doesn't have the prettiest look but , tests high 20's , yields huge, only down fall is she is one leafy bitch..

Looking good man. Wait till you try this UW X Albert Walker #1. It looks just like the Albert, smells like it, but is much denser. I think it could be a winner. The #6 is an interesting one as well, with some kind of a different nose to it. Both are going to get another run.

I think the Albert was ahead of it's time, and didn't come around when people were making large scale oil for dabs and pens. If it had, it would have blown up like the Tangie.

I know nothing about this cut but it looks really like my Blood Orange keeper from Bodhi seeds wich is Cali O x Appalachia, this cut smell so much of orange and funk that it can be too much, some friends prefer to grow it in hydro set-up rather than soil to have a weaker smell for the end product.
Do you know the genetics of your cut? On scale to 10 how do you rate the power of the smell?

She stinks I'd give her 9.5-10 .... got kicked out of many places for having a sack in my pocket back when I ran her out east. her loudness lol is up there with sour n cheese... but all 3 are completely different types of odors equally pungent... she is a very old clone but I can only speculate on the linage as it's not known. Best guess would be orange skunk pheno... with all the new orange flavs out there I try she beats them all...
